While these hearing aids were adequate for the most part, there are some things that I didn't like. The battery charging cases only charge while they are plugged in, in other words, the cases themselves don't have a battery to hold a charge. Some other hearing aid cases do have a battery to hold a charge for a few days. The hearing aids themselves would sometimes go in and out of connecting with my iphone which was annoying. But, they were much cheaper than some of the other brands, so it all depends on how important it is to you that you can recharge your hearing aids without electricity and how often you depend on your hearing aids to connect with your phone.

Fast shipping, fit well, multiple domes types provided for best fit. App programing is a joke. No adjustment of individual frequencies. Volume, temble/bass, and balance is what you get. To change enviromemt, Aides must be powered off and back on ,what a joke gonna do this in a restaurant or bar. BEST Amplifiers/not true hearing aides!
